Contents/Notes (continue on back):
clowning e.5000 years old (Egypt)
1. Designed makeup in clown college
2. Grease makeup to avoid it washing off w/ sweat.
3. Core Makeup Design Conventions
4. -makeup where things move (lower lip & eyebrows)
5. -don't highlight still areas
6. Costumes: Large for usefulness [[arrow]] |pockets/ease of putting on| & comedy
7. Venice clowns - 10th cent. - El Capitano: powerful looking [[strikethrough]] acting then instant switch to timid
Collimina : always making trouble 
8.
Different actions/movements for different characters 
Basic makeup colors: white,black,red
